Sikh Indian Wedding Ceremony: Anand Karaj
The Sikh Anand Karaj (Ceremony of Bliss) is conducted in the Gurdwara (Sikh temple). The Baraat arrives at the Gurdwara with the groom traditionally on horseback along with a young boy. The close family and friends from the bride and groom’s side meet to perform the Ardaas (Sikh Prayer). This is followed by the Milni ceremony where members of both sides meet and exchange hugs, garlands and well wishes.

Honeymoon Destination: Puerto Rico
Puerto Rico is a convenient, tropical destination with an extensive list of activities, resorts and beaches. The region offers lodging on both ends of the cost spectrum. It offers a plethora of activities for the adventure-seeking Indiana Jones types, to the sun-soaking beach bums. Given that it is a U.S. territory, U.S. citizens and permanent residents will not have to deal with any hassles of visas and immigration.
